Overview

Aired on Omnibus , Forty-Five Minutes From Broadway is a three-act musical by George M. Cohan written about the town of New Rochelle, New York. The title refers to the 45-minute train ride from New Rochelle to Broadway. The story concerns a romance between a maid who stands to inherit a fortune and an unpopular out-of-towner. The musical premiered on Broadway in 1906 and was briefly revived in 1912. Broadcast live on television on March 15, 1959.
